Output 23c80d3edd106e3faf5f0442615371ee6f402e7a8b9ddfd5b0087d270dc5598e:3
- value
- 75893
- script pubkey
- OP_0 OP_PUSHBYTES_20 ffcfb111db1e67d44295403ae3ec24cd2ddf4180
- address
- tb1qll8mzywmrenags54gqaw8mpye5ka7svql44amz
- transaction
- 23c80d3edd106e3faf5f0442615371ee6f402e7a8b9ddfd5b0087d270dc5598e